Development and implementation of a hospital-based patient safety program.

Karen S Frush1, Michael Alton, Donald P Frush

  • 1Office of Patient Safety and Clinical Quality, Duke University Health System, Durham, NC 27710, USA. frush002@mc.duke.edu

Pediatric Radiology
|February 28, 2006
PubMed
Summary

Implementing a hospital patient safety program is crucial for reducing medical errors. This approach focuses on safety teams, tools, and continuous improvement to enhance patient care and safety culture.

Area of Science:

  • Healthcare Quality Improvement
  • Patient Safety Research
  • Medical Error Prevention

Background:

  • Medical errors significantly harm patients in US healthcare settings.
  • The 1999 Institute of Medicine report emphasized establishing safety programs to foster a culture of safety.
  • Patient safety remains a critical concern in healthcare delivery.

Purpose of the Study:

  • To describe a successful approach to implementing a hospital-based patient safety program.
  • To provide a replicable model for healthcare practices aiming to improve patient safety.
  • To highlight key components for developing and sustaining a patient safety initiative.

Main Methods:

  • Development of dedicated safety teams within the healthcare system.
  • Provision of practical tools to support safety teams and foster a safe environment.

  • Ongoing program modification based on patient and staff needs and evolving priorities.
  • Main Results:

    • Successful implementation of a hospital-based patient safety program demonstrated.
    • Application of principles and solutions adaptable to various healthcare settings.
    • Enhanced culture of safety and awareness of potential medical errors.

    Conclusions:

    • A structured patient safety program can effectively reduce medical errors and prevent patient harm.
    • Fostering a culture of safety through dedicated teams and tools is essential.
    • Continuous program adaptation is key to meeting healthcare needs and improving patient outcomes.
